Bryton James is an American actor and singer best known for his role as Devon Hamilton on the long running CBS soap opera The Young and the Restless. Over more than two decades onscreen, he has built a steady income from acting, music, and endorsements, contributing to an estimated net worth in the low millions.

The Young And The Restless Era
Role As Devon Hamilton
Since joining The Young and the Restless in the early 2000s, Bryton James has portrayed Devon Hamilton, a character with complex storylines and strong audience connection. This long term role represents the core of his public identity and a substantial portion of his income. Consistent employment on a major soap opera typically offers reliable salary structures and benefits.
